Every night at the Blakely family dinner table, Sara’s father would ask each child the same question: “What did you fail at today?” The best answer wasn’t zero failures, it was the biggest, boldest failure. That single habit rewired her entire relationship with rejection. Fresh out of college, Sara spent seven years selling fax machines door-to-door, hearing “No” hundreds of times a week. Instead of quitting, she studied those rejections like a scientist. When the idea for footless pantyhose hit her on a flight in 1998, she used her entire life savings, taught herself patent law, manufactured the first prototypes in her apartment, and famously pitched a Neiman Marcus buyer from a bathroom stall. Today Spanx is a household name. Sara is a self-made billionaire who still credits every early “No” as the rocket fuel that got her there. Chobani founder Hamdi Ulukaya viewed his early manufacturing failures as a supply chain masterclass. 🥛🚀

Halfway across the country, Hamdi Ulukaya (founder of Chobani) faced repeated manufacturing failures and distributor rejections when he first tried to bring Greek yogurt to America. He nearly lost everything until he decided the “failures” were simply the price of learning the supply chain. Today Chobani is a billion-dollar brand, and Ulukaya still says his early rejections taught him more than any business school ever could.

How To Start Today 🏃‍➡️

  1. Adopt the Dinner Table Question: Every evening, ask yourself (or your family): “What did I fail at today?” Celebrate the attempt, not the outcome.

  2. Build Daily Rejection Exposure: Make one small ask every day that has a high chance of “No.” Sales call, partnership pitch, content idea. Normalize hearing it.

  3. Visualize the Win + Study the Gap: Spend five minutes picturing the empire, then immediately list the next tiny actionable step. Sara didn’t just dream; she patented, prototyped, and pitched.

  4. Document Your Pivot Moments: Keep a simple “Rejection Journal.” Next to every “No,” write what you learned and the next experiment it inspired.
